#42719b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#42719b is composed of 25.9% red, 44.3%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#42719b color hex could be obtained by blending #84e2ff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#42719b color description : Dark moderate blue.

#42719b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#42719b has RGB values of R:66, G:113,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4354459.

Shades and Tints of #42719b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#42719b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6f71 is the less saturated color, while #0774d7 is the most saturated one.
